Why Are You Losing Customers?

If you’re not getting enough customers for your auto-detailing business, there could be any number of reasons why. Finding the root cause is essential so you can address it effectively. Some potential causes for losing customers include:

1. Ineffective Marketing Strategies

Are you getting the word out about your business? Your marketing strategy may be holding back your business venture. It would be best to have an effective advertising plan to make people come to your business and make it visible. Consider ways such as flyers, local radio advertising, social media, and even billboards that can help your business get the recognition it deserves.

2. Neglected Online Presence

Believe it or not, your online presence could make or break your business. With the advent of technology and social media, almost all businesses are compelled to have an online presence, but keeping it updated and regularly posting about your offers and promotions is essential. Use social media platforms like Facebook and Instagram to advertise your business effectively.

3. Limited Services

A crucial reason your auto-detailing business may lack customers is the limited services you offer. If you’re only doing the basics, nothing can differentiate you from all the other auto-detailing businesses in your vicinity. Expand your services, such as paint corrections, ceramic coatings, and protective films. In doing so, you enhance your service offerings, providing customers with more than just the basics.

4. Inconsistent Quality

Customers are not just looking for an auto-detailing business; they want the best service. Providing inconsistent quality of services can make your customers skeptical of your services’ reliability, leading to a lack of customer retention. Ensure that you consistently maintain the quality of services you can provide.

5. Poor Customer Service

Customer service is the backbone of any business, and many businesses are losing money because of poor customer service. That’s why giving it the attention it deserves is essential. A poor customer service experience will cost your business customers. Ensure that you have well-trained and friendly staff to handle customer queries and complaints in a professional and friendly manner.

Proactive Tips to Get More Customers

There are four extra tips you can use to get more customers. Here are those tips:

1. Put Your Best Foot Forward

Always put your best foot forward when it comes to business. Present yourself professionally with a neat shop, knowledgeable staff, and quality products. It can make all the difference in attracting customers and setting your business apart from competitors.

2. Get Creative With Promotions

Getting creative with promotions is one of the best strategies to attract customers. Try discounts on services, coupons, and special offers for loyal and new customers. All these can help you get more customers in the door.

3. Build a Network

Networking is another way to bring in more business. Get connected with other auto-repair shops and businesses that may need your services or be willing to collaborate. Doing so will help you get more referrals and customers.

4. Offer Referral Programs

Offering referral programs is one of the best ways to increase your customer base. Give discounts or rewards to your existing customers for referring your business to other people who may need auto-detailing services. This can boost your business and increase its cost over time.
